A test product that undergoes damaging testing becomes unsalvageable. At times, complete machines should be discarded. Some examples of damaging techniques that develop wastage are tensile assessments, three-level bend exams, impact checks and fall checks.

Oil and Gas Market: Acoustic emission screening is applied to watch the integrity of pipelines and storage tanks. Detecting and addressing problems like corrosion and leaks early can help reduce environmental hazards and costly repairs.

Non-damaging screening (NDT) is definitely an evaluation of parts or workpieces for their high-quality and structure that does not damage or impair them.
